<p><br/> I use a astro base (matt silver form the 90s I think) with a heritage clear and turquise bottle. It over heats in about 3 to 4 hours with a 40w spot bulb, but it work perfectly with a 30w spot bulb and doesnt overheat even if you leave it on all night. Its take 2 hours exactly to start flowing. <br/> <cite>Kaia1165 said:</cite></p>
<blockquote cite="http://oozinggoo.ning.com/forum/topics/mathmos-herritage-bottles-don-t-work-with-a-polished-base?commentId=1566398%3AComment%3A581333#1566398Comment580841"><div><div class="xg_user_generated"><p>The new chrome Astro uses a 35w halogen lamp. The old astro uses a 40w halogen lamp. if you put a 40w halogen lamp in the heritage bases with a normal (non heritage) bottle it will flow correctly. The heritage bases take more heat than the regular bases, so they make the fluid different to compensate. Just use a hotter bulb.</p>

<p>The heritage globes will overheat on the new polished bases.<br/> I have three heritage globes, blue-turquoise, orange, plum-black. <br/> I run them on the older type bases using 25w bulbs.<br/> However they take forever to get flowing on 25w and the blue and orange start of very grainy and are always full of bubbles. The plum is silky at all times. <br/> So... I start them of on a base with a 40w bulb to full flow and when the wax is silky and bubble free (about 2hrs) I put them on to a 25w base and they flow as they should.<br/> I don't own the newer type polished halogen base but am lucky enough to have the heritage black base which does take a long time to get the globes flowing.<br/> I really need to get me a dimmer again !!!.... If you take a 40 Watt bulb in a silver Base toped with a heritage bottle, you need a dimmer!<br />
Or you have to take a smaller Watt! Try a 30 Watt spot, like in a baby or a 25 Watt clear bulb!<br />
It takes longer untill it flows, but then it runs very good!
